Collection type
Object
Description
Amulet. Piece of skin of a camel. Irregular in shape with light brown and black hair attached. To cure pain in the head. [AF [OPS Move] 24/11/2017]
Geographical reference
Date
Date collected
1929
Acquisition information
Transferred: 1985
Materials and processes
Material Camel Hide Skin Camelid Animal
Dimensions
Width: max 59 mm, Width: max 12 mm, Length: max 106 mm
Object numbers
Accession number: 1985.54.2842 Other numbers: A 70054 R 30238
